I-Epidemiology
I-Aspirin, njengeyeza elisebenzayo le-anti-platelet aggregation drug, lisetyenziswa ngokubanzi ekuthinteleni nasekunyangelweni kwezifo ze-cardiovascular and cerebrovascular.Uphononongo lufumanisa ukuba ezinye izigulane zifunyenwe zingakwazi ukuthintela ngokufanelekileyo umsebenzi weeplatelet nangona ukusetyenziswa kwexesha elide le-aspirin ye-dose ephantsi, oko kukuthi, ukuxhathisa i-aspirin (AR). Izinga limalunga nama-50% -60%, kwaye kukho umahluko ocacileyo wobuhlanga. I-Glycoprotein IIb / IIIa (GPI IIb / IIIa) idlala indima ebalulekileyo kwi-platelet aggregation kunye ne-thrombosis enzima kwiindawo zokulimala kwe-vascular. Uphononongo lubonise ukuba i-polymorphisms ye-gene idlala indima ebalulekileyo ekuxhathiseni i-aspirin, ngokukodwa igxininise kwi-GPIIIa P1A1 / A2, PEAR1 kunye ne-PTGS1 i-polymorphisms ye-gene. I-GPIIa P1A2 yeyona geni iphambili yokuxhathisa i-aspirin. Ukuguqulwa kwenguqu kule gene kuguqula isakhiwo se-GPIIb / IIIa receptors, okubangelwa ukudibanisa phakathi kweeplatelet kunye neplatelet aggregation. Uphononongo lufumene ukuba ukuphindaphinda kwe-P1A2 alleles kwizigulane ezinganyangekiyo kwi-aspirin kwakuphezulu kakhulu kunezigulana ezithintekayo kwi-aspirin, kwaye izigulane ezine-P1A2 / A2 zokuguqulwa kwe-homozygous zazingasebenzi kakuhle emva kokuthatha i-aspirin. Izigulane ezine-P1A2 alleles eziguquguqukayo eziphantsi kwe-stenting zinezinga lesiganeko se-subacute thrombotic esiphindwe kahlanu kune-P1A1 izigulane zohlobo lwe-homozygous zasendle, ezifuna iidosi eziphezulu ze-aspirin ukufezekisa iziphumo ze-anticoagulant. I-PEAR1 GG allele iphendula kakuhle kwi-aspirin, kunye nezigulane ezine-AA okanye i-AG genotype ethatha i-aspirin (okanye idibaniswe ne-clopidogrel) emva kokufakelwa kwe-stent ine-infarction ephezulu ye-myocardial kunye nokufa. I-PTGS1 GG genotype inomngcipheko omkhulu wokumelana ne-aspirin (HR: 10) kunye neziganeko eziphezulu ze-cardiovascular events (HR: 2.55). I-AG genotype inomngcipheko ophakathi, kwaye ingqalelo esondeleyo kufuneka ihlawulwe kwisiphumo sonyango lwe-aspirin. I-AA genotype ivakalelwa ngakumbi kwi-aspirin, kwaye iziganeko zeziganeko ze-cardiovascular zincinci. Iziphumo zobhaqo zale mveliso zimele kuphela iziphumo zofuzo lwabantu be-PEAR1, PTGS1, kunye ne-GPIIIa.
